Pearl
"The precious one" — a Victorian gem name of deep luster, quiet beauty, and timeless worth
Pearl is a gem name of extraordinary heritage, derived from the Latin perla and referring to the lustrous organic jewel formed within oysters and mollusks. Pearls have been prized across cultures for millennia as symbols of purity, wisdom, and hidden depth—they are the only precious gems made by a living creature, formed through patience and beauty from an irritant. As a Victorian gem name, Pearl was immensely popular in the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ries and is now experiencing a charming revival as parents rediscover its quiet radiance.
